24. City of AlgonacThe mere beauty of the river is just one of the many treasures that attract numerous tourists to the city of Algonac. The St. Clair River contains many species of fish and is one of the best walleye fishing rivers in all of the Great Lakes. At night, you can sit on the boardwalk and watch the flicker of lights as local fishermen go after their limit of walleye. www.algonac-mi.govLAT: 42.6111040 LONG: -82.5262280
25. Marine CityOnce the shipbuilding center of the Great Lakes, this historic downtown is home to five waterfront parks, numerous antique stores, gracious Victorian architecture and unique shops and dining venues. Visitors to the area can find great antique buys, enjoy public beaches, stroll on the historic boardwalk and more. Marine City is also a gateway to Canada, with a ferry to Sombra, Ontario. www.visitmarinecity.com
26. St. ClairThe centerpiece of downtown St. Clair is Palmer Park, the community’s defining public space. With the longest freshwater boardwalk in the world, it’s a great place to watch the freighters go by. Throughout the year, visitors can enjoy art shows, bands and movies on the boardwalk; concerts in the courtyard; boat shows; fishing contests; offshore boat races; historical reenactments; fireworks; ice cream; nature walks and more. www.stclairontheriver.comLAT: 42.8257700 LONG: -82.4866230

31. Port HuronPort Huron is located at the base of Lake Huron, connecting boaters to Lake St. Clair via the St. Clair River and visitors to Canada via the spectacular Blue Water Bridge. With seven miles of shoreline along the river, this waterfront community boasts a large historic downtown with dozens of shops, restaurants and activities that connect visitors to the water and history of the region. www.downtownporthuron.orgLAT: 42.98 LONG: 82.44
32. The Blue Water BridgeSituated at the southern end of Lake Huron and the mouth of the St. Clair River, the Blue Water Bridge serves as an international crossing connecting the cities of Port Huron and Sarnia. Built in the 1930s with a second span added in 1997, the bridge stands at 6,178 feet and is the second busiest border crossing between the U.S. and Canada.www.bwba.org/bridgeinfo_e.htmlLAT: 42.9707970 LONG: -82.4079650

43. Detroit/Windsor TunnelFirst opened in 1930, the tunnel is jointly owned by the cities of Windsor and Detroit and is operated under two separate agreements by the Detroit and Canada Tunnel Corporation. Approximately 27,000 to 29,000 vehicles pass through the tunnel on a daily basis. It handles almost nine million vehicles per year, of which 95% are cars and 5% are trucks. Detroit side located at 100 E. Jefferson Ave.; Windsor side situated at Goyeau and Park Streets. www.dwtunnel.comWINDSOR: LAT: 42.319264 LONG: -83.038491 DETROIT: LAT: 42.328604 LONG: -83.042018
44. The Ambassador BridgeThe Ambassador Bridge opened for traffic in mid-November of 1929. Its almost 21,000 tons of steel and 1,850-foot center span made it the longest suspension bridge in the world. Today, the Ambassador Bridge remains the only suspension bridge to link the U.S. and Canada in Detroit, where more than 10 million vehicles cross each year.www.ambassadorbridge.comLAT: 42.3186020 LONG: -83.0764660

47. Belle Isle State ParkBelle Isle is an outdoor recreation haven mixed with beautiful architectural landmarks and a century plus of history. Visitors to this 982-acre island park can enjoy fishing from the island’s shores and piers, games at the 36-acre athletic fields, public beach, nature zoo, 9-hole golf course and driving range. www.michigan.org/property/belle-isle-parkLAT: 42.3524770 LONG: -82.9939880

50. Edsel and Eleanor Ford HouseLocated on 87 acres of vistas along the shore of Lake St. Clair, this was the private residence of Henry and Clara Ford’s only child Edsel and his wife, Eleanor. Its impressive landscaping includes meadows, rockwork and water components by Jens Jenson. It is open to the public with special events, classes, lectures and tours, including the historic Gate Lodge Garage.www.fordhouse.orgLAT: 42.4511454 LONG: -82.8729171
